Harold courlander september 18, 1908 march 15, 1996 was an american novelist, folklorist, and anthropologist and an expert in the study of haitian life. The author of 35 books and plays and numerous scholarly articles, courlander specialized in the study of african, caribbean, afroamerican, and native american cultures. Harold courlander was born on september 18, 1908 in indianapolis, indiana, usa as harold aaron courlander. He was married to emma meltzer and ella schneiderman. He died on march 15, 1996 in bethesda, maryland, usa.
